

Elma was born May 31, 1957 in Columbus County, daughter of Paul Gore and the late Phyllis Milligan Gore. She was a hard worker and a dedicated caregiver to her father for many years. Elma enjoyed spending time with her family, watching westerns and crime scene shows. Before her illness, she enjoyed working in her flowers and feeding her many hummingbirds.
In addition to her father, survivors include her children, Stephanie McCumbee (David) of Ash and Hanna Maroney (Jarrad) of Simpsonville, South Carolina; very special friend and caregiver, Jammie King of Ash; brothers, Ernie Gore (Monica) of Ash, Timmy Gore of Bolivia, and Mark Gore (Gina) of Shallotte; sister, Nicole King (Randy) of Ash; six grandchildren, Paige, Allie, Brandon, Jasmine, Kohen, and Cain; three great grandchildren, Natalie, Bryson, and Landon; and her special canine companion who stayed by her side, Ryder.
Funeral services will be Wednesday, October 13, 2021 at three o'clock in the afternoon at Zion Baptist Church in Ash with Reverend Jason Benton officiating. Burial will follow in Griffin Cemetery.
The family will receive friends one hour prior to the service at the church.
Pallbearers will be Jarrad Maroney, David McCumbee, Paul Ruiz, Taylor Parker, Dawson King, and Adam Milligan.
In lieu of flowers memorials may be made to Lower Cape Fear Hospice, 955 Mercy Lane, Bolivia, North Carolina or Miracle Hill Ministries, c/o Renewal Center, 490 S. Pleasantburg Drive, Greenville, South Carolina 29602.
